Technical Specifications – Stamping & Welding Capabilities:

Precision Stamping Process:

Our presses range from 250 tons to 800 tons, enabling tight tolerances on the u shaped beam bracket inner width, typically ±0.3 mm. Critical dimensions include web height, flange length, and hole center distances. Compared to laser-cut brackets, a stamped one delivers work-hardened edges and faster cycle times for bulk orders.

Welding Standards:

As a welded fabrication specialist, we apply GMAW (MAG welding) for structural steel brackets, ensuring penetration depth at least 80% of material thickness. Resistance projection welding is used for high-volume u shaped beam bracket units with pre-embossed weld projections. Post-weld finishing includes grinding or shot blasting to remove spatter, ensuring a clean surface for coating.

Every batch of the product undergoes pull-out testing and shear testing. For seismic or high-vibration environments, we recommend a reinforced u shaped beam bracket with gusset plates welded at stress points.

Typical Applications for U Shaped Beam Bracket:

Solar Tracker Mounting Structures:

The solar industry requires corrosion-resistant u shaped beam bracket components that can handle torque from single-axis trackers. Our galvanized version has passed 1,000-hour salt spray testing per ASTM B117.

Warehouse Cantilever Racks:

A heavy-duty u shaped beam bracket acts as the arm support for storing long materials such as steel pipes, lumber, or aluminum extrusions. We can customize bracket depth from 100 mm to 400 mm.

Conveyor System Supports:

Belt conveyors often use a u shaped beam bracket to hang idler rollers between C-channels. Slotted holes in our stamped design accommodate thermal expansion and alignment adjustments.

Automotive Frame Fixtures:

In body-in-white (BIW) tooling, a precision u shaped beam bracket serves as a locating anchor for welding guns. Our welded units maintain flatness within 0.5 mm over one meter.

Material Grades and Surface Treatment Options for U Shaped Beam Bracket:

Choosing the right material for your u shaped beam bracket directly impacts structural integrity and service life. We offer hot rolled steel grades such as Q235B, Q355B, and ASTM A36 for general fabrication. For corrosion prone environments like coastal solar farms or food processing facilities, a stainless steel u shaped beam bracket in SS304 or SS316L provides excellent rust resistance. Galvanized steel is another popular choice when budget and weather resistance must be balanced. Every u shaped beam bracket can be further protected with zinc plating reaching 8 to 12 microns, or powder coating in any RAL color for additional abrasion resistance. Our welding process is fully compatible with all these materials, ensuring consistent penetration and spatter control regardless of the substrate.

Common Installation Mistakes to Avoid With U Shaped Beam Bracket:

Even a perfect u shaped beam bracket will fail if installed incorrectly. One common mistake is using undersized bolts. The bolt diameter should match the hole without excessive play because loose fasteners concentrate stress its edges. Another mistake is omitting flat washers under bolt heads and nuts, which allows the u shaped beam bracket surface to deform over time.

Over torquing is also problematic because it can strip threads or crush its legs inward, changing the effective inner width. For welded attachments, never weld additional components onto a u shaped beam bracket without recalculating heat affected zone strength. Field welding after zinc coating releases toxic fumes and weakens the metal. If you need field modifications, order an uncoated u shaped beam bracket and apply touch up paint after welding. Following these guidelines will maximize the service life of your u shaped beam bracket assembly.

Frequently Asked Questions:

Q: Can a stamped U-shaped bracket replace a cast bracket?
A: Yes, for applications requiring consistent ductility. Our stamped and welded version offers better impact resistance than brittle cast iron and is typically 15 to 20 percent lighter.

Q: Do you provide welded assemblies with two U-shaped brackets on a single plate?
A: Absolutely. This is called a twin-bracket assembly and is often used to support purlins in mezzanine floors or double-beam structures.

Q: What is the maximum load for one U-shaped bracket?
A: Static load depends on material thickness and weld size. For a 4.0 mm steel bracket with 5 mm fillet welds, the safe working load is approximately 2,800 kg per unit. Contact us for a detailed calculation sheet.

Q: Can you add rubber pads inside the U-shaped bracket?
A: We do not mold rubber, but we can bond pre-cut EPDM pads after welding. For anti-vibration requirements, specify a rubber-lined version.
